Abstract

An automatic injection device for providing a injection is disclosed. The device includes a housing having a distal end operable by a user and an open proximal end for placement at an injection site. The device includes a syringe movably disposed in the housing. The syringe includes a needle and substance for injection. The device also includes a plunger that has a continuous length from a first end to a second end and includes an anchoring portion initially engaged with the distal end of the housing in a latched position. The device also includes a biasing mechanism to apply pressure to the plunger when activated and move the plunger towards the proximal end of the housing, and a firing mechanism assembly operable by the user to release the anchoring portion.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. An automatic injection device for providing an injection of a substance into a user, the automatic injection device comprising:
 a housing having a distal end operable by a user and an open proximal end for placement at an injection site;   a syringe movably disposed within the housing, the syringe having a needle and the substance contained therein;   a plunger having a continuous length from a first end to a second end opposite the first end, the first end extending into a barrel of the syringe and the second end initially seated on a retaining flange disposed within the distal end of the housing;   a radially shaped damper disposed within the housing to damp movement of the syringe;   a biasing mechanism disposed in the distal end of the housing and configured to apply pressure to the plunger when activated and move the plunger towards the proximal end of the housing; and   a firing mechanism assembly operable by the user to unseat the second end of the plunger from the syringe from the retaining flange.   
     
     
         2 . The automatic injection device of  claim 1 , wherein the plunger is configured to move the syringe towards the proximal end of the housing and cause the needle to protrude from the proximal end of the housing in a first stage of operation. 
     
     
         3 . The automatic injection device of  claim 2 , further comprising a stopping mechanism configured to stop further movement of the syringe towards the proximal end of the housing in a second stage of operation. 
     
     
         4 . The automatic injection device of  claim 1 , further comprising a flange disposed on the plunger between the first end and the second end of the plunger, wherein the flange is configured to hold the biasing mechanism in a compressed position until activation. 
     
     
         5 . The automatic injection device of  claim 4 , wherein the plunger includes a base extending from the flange towards the distal end of the housing. 
     
     
         6 . The automatic injection device of  claim 5 , wherein the base terminates in an anchoring portion for holding the biasing mechanism in a retracted position. 
     
     
         7 . The automatic injection device of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 a spring disposed in the proximal end of the housing and configured to hold the syringe in a retracted position.   
     
     
         8 . The automatic injection device of  claim 1 , wherein the plunger extends through the biasing mechanism. 
     
     
         9 . The automatic injection device of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 a syringe carrier disposed in the housing surrounding the syringe.   
     
     
         10 . The automatic injection device of  claim 9 , wherein the plunger is configured to move the syringe carrier. 
     
     
         11 . The automatic injection device of  claim 10 , wherein the stopping mechanism limits movement of the syringe carrier, and the syringe carrier limits movement of the syringe towards the proximal end of the housing. 
     
     
         12 . (canceled) 
     
     
         13 . The automatic injection device of  claim 9 , wherein the syringe carrier comprises a proximate anchor portion to limit movement of the syringe towards the distal end of the housing. 
     
     
         14 . The automatic injection device of  claim 9 , wherein the syringe carrier comprises cutouts that align with a window of the housing. 
     
     
         15 . The automatic injection device of  claim 1 , wherein the second end of the plunger is bifurcated and includes two arms. 
     
     
         16 . The automatic injection device of  claim 9 , wherein the radially shaped damper is disposed at a distal end of the syringe carrier to damp movement of the syringe. 
     
     
         17 . The automatic injection device of  claim 1 , wherein the plunger is a unitary plunger. 
     
     
         18 . The automatic injection device of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 a trigger to retain the biasing mechanism in a latched position; and   an activation button that when actuated causes the trigger to release the biasing mechanism.
